Petroleum Coke

 
Petroleum coke, often abbreviated as pet coke, is derived from the thermal decomposition of heavy residual oil in coker units during the refining of crude oil. This process yields a carbonaceous material with diverse properties, ranging from fuel-grade coke used in power generation to high-quality calcined coke utilized in the production of electrodes for aluminum smelting.

Process of HGM Grinding Mill Processing Petroleum Coke

 
  • Preparation: The petroleum coke feedstock undergoes preliminary preparation, including crushing and drying, to ensure optimal grinding efficiency and product quality.
 
  • Grinding: The dried petroleum coke is fed into the HGM grinding mill, where it undergoes intensive grinding to achieve the desired particle size distribution. Utilizing advanced grinding technology, HGM mills deliver ultrafine powders with uniformity and precision.
 
  • Classification: Following grinding, the ground petroleum coke powder may undergo classification to separate fine particles from coarse ones, further enhancing product quality and consistency.

Applications of Ground Petroleum Coke Powder:

 
The finely ground petroleum coke powder produced by HGM grinding mills finds applications across numerous industries, including:
 
  • Cement Production: Petroleum coke powder serves as a supplementary fuel in cement kilns, enhancing energy efficiency and reducing greenhouse gas emissions.
 
  • Power Generation: Fuel-grade petroleum coke powder is utilized in power plants for steam generation, providing a cost-effective and environmentally friendly energy source.
 
  • Aluminum Smelting: Calcined petroleum coke powder is essential in the production of carbon anodes for aluminum smelting, ensuring optimal conductivity and efficiency in the electrolytic process.
 
  • Steelmaking: Petroleum coke powder acts as a carbon additive in steelmaking, enhancing the quality and properties of steel while reducing production costs.
 
  • Refractory Materials: Ground petroleum coke powder is incorporated into refractory materials, improving their thermal stability and resistance to high temperatures in industrial furnaces and kilns.
